Lighting is one of the most transformative aspects of event décor. It can dramatically alter the perception of a space and emphasize important areas such as stages, entrances, or focal displays. Soft and warm lighting creates a cozy, inviting atmosphere, while vibrant, dynamic lights energize the room and encourage interaction among guests. Advanced techniques, including uplighting, projections, and LED installations, allow designers to create immersive environments that leave a strong impression. Properly planned lighting can enhance colors, textures, and decorative features, making every element of the décor stand out beautifully.

Floral arrangements and greenery are timeless components that bring life and elegance to any event. Flowers not only add color and fragrance but also symbolize beauty, celebration, and emotion. From grand centerpieces to subtle accents, the strategic placement of flowers enhances the theme and atmosphere. Greenery such as garlands, vines, and potted plants can complement floral designs while adding freshness and a natural aesthetic. The combination of flowers, plants, fabrics, and other decorative elements creates harmony within the space, giving it a polished and professional appearance that captivates guests.
